Alexander Zverev through to Round 3 at French Open after straight-set win over David Goffin

German World Number 4 continues run with 7-6(4), 6-2, 6-2 victory on Court Suzanne-Lenglen

By Emre Asikci

ISTANBUL (AA) — Alexander Zverev defeated David Goffin in straight sets to reach the third round at the French Open on Thursday.

Playing in Paris' Court Suzanne-Lenglen, world no. 4 Zverev won the round two with sets of 7-6(4), 6-2 and 6-2.

"I was happy that I ran away with it but also happy that I played well," Zverev, 27, after the win.

Zverev, who eliminated 14-times champion Rafael Nadal in his opener, will face the winner of the Luciano Darderi-Tallon Griekspoor clash.
